    HKSAR v. YIP HON WING

    Citation
    HKSAR v. YIP HON WING
    Court
    Court of Appeal
    Case number
    CACC484/2001

    The Court held that section 32 permitted amendment because the transcripts of covert recordings provided prima facie evidence supporting the broader particulars; the defence had not been misled by the prosecution and suffered no substantial injustice that could not be cured by recall or further cross-examination; fresh consent of the Secretary for Justice was not required in the circumstances; conviction was therefore safe and the sentence of 2 years 3 months was not excessive.
